El Toro Bruto started as a simple pop-up serving incredible breakfast tacos and gained such a cult following that it opened up permanently inside Resident Culture South End. The all-day menu will satisfy taste buds throughout the day and it’s up to you whether you pair them with a coffee or a cold, local beer. In addition to breakfast tacos, the menu includes “anytime” tacos, snacks, and “dilla” tacos (like tacos and quesadillas had a child). Fans of chef Hector González-Mora’s breakfast tacos will be stoked to see past favorites on the menu, plus new chorizo, bacon, barbacoa, steak and eggs, and even a tasty vegan option. If you’re really hungry, Tacos Brutos are “a beast of a taco” and as grand as a burrito. Think a six-inch flour tortilla with griddled cheese, meat (or poblano peppers for vegetarians) beans, cilantro, onions, pico de gallo, and salsa. A mix of traditional Mexican pastries and American baked goods are served fresh by González-Mora and whatever you do, don’t miss out on the Dirty Horchata drink—El Toro Bruto’s house-made horchata elevated with espresso and topped with cinnamon sugar.
